Zusammenfassung:The hydrolysis of the title compounds was studied in order to investigate the possibility of their usage as drugs or pesticides. It was found that there were two different pathways of hydrolysis according to the pH region of the solution. In the acidic pH region, the P-N bond cleaves for the both compounds. In the basic pH region, the P-C and P-O bonds would cleave for the compound of N-(methoxycarbonyl-methoxyphosphonyl)-α-amino acid ester (I). While for the compound of N-(isopropylcarbamoyl-methoxyphosphony1)-α-amino acid ester (11). only the P-O bond cleaves. The possible mechanism is discussed.
